About EDX

EDX is the moniker of Swiss DJ Maurizio Colella, who has been producing and spinning tuneful, summery house tracks since the mid-'90s. After a decade of singles, he issued his official studio debut, On the Edge, in 2012, followed by Two Decades in 2017. Born in Zurich, Switzerland, to Italian parents, he started getting into house music during the '90s, looking up to American producers such as David Morales and Armand Van Helden, as well as British DJs like Carl Cox. Initially active as a DJ, he began releasing house tracks near the end of the decade, often in collaboration with Leon Klein, on labels such as Energetic Records and Club Control. EDX released several mix CDs on Energetic (both solo and with Klein), usually as part of the Evolution and Energy series. Around 2005, EDX went on a brief hiatus, but he returned in 2007, shifting to more of a progressive house sound, rather than more traditional house. He remixed tracks by Dubfire, Deadmau5, and Armin van Buuren, and he released numerous singles on PinkStar and Toolroom Records, among other labels. He launched a popular radio show/podcast titled No Xcuses, and held a residency at Ibiza superclub Space in 2011. Armada released EDX's double mix CD No Xcuses - The Violet Edition in 2011. The following year, EDX's debut full-length, On the Edge, was released, followed two years later by a remix album. Subsequent singles appeared on disco:wax and Spinnin' Records, and EDX remixed songs by Robin Schulz, Sam Feldt, and Lika Morgan. His sophomore set, the appropriately titled Two Decades, landed in 2017. Meanwhile, he continued to deliver remixes, putting his spin on tracks by the likes of Charlie Puth, Janelle Monáe, and David Guetta. In 2019, he issued the singles "Who Cares" and "Off the Grid," which featured Amba Shepherd. ~ Paul Simpson
